Job Summary

This internship will support accounting team during Budget, CIP preparation, and help with backfill during the Yardi replacement assessment / project and Maximo integration / data validation and inventory reconciliations.

This position will engage with all aspects of full-cycle accounting to include transaction processing, journal entries and account reconciliations as well as the preparation and analysis of financial managerial reporting. This will be a great opportunity for someone to have exposure to an entire financial operation and understand how an organization depends on this critical work.

This internship is expected to start on or around June 1st for up to 3 months.

Hours will be Monday-Friday, 20-24 hours a week between 8 am and 5 pm.

Essential Functions

Applicants must be enrolled in an accredited four-year college, university or enrolled in an accredited graduate school. Coursework and interest in accounting, and related fields is preferred.

Applicants must be proficient in Microsoft Office software applications. Strong oral and written communication skills and comfort with numbers and quantitative reasoning are necessary. Experience with Microsoft Excel is preferred. This position requires a strong attention to detail, and the ability to work with supervision from a variety of subject matter experts.
